E-SOURCING/PROCUREMENT MANAGEMENT
ENHANCEMENTS

ENHANCEMENT:  Add email options back to Solicitations and update Q&A table emailer
Reference #: 250624.1259.9696

The option to Email Respondents and Email Awarded Vendors has been added to the Email Dock on Solicitation Records. These options appear as buttons next to the send email button when requirements are met. The Email Respondents button will appear on the dock after you have assigned a Respondent to the Solicitation record and the Record is set to invite only or Public, if neither of those options are assigned than the Email Respondents button will remain hidden. The Solicitations Questions and Answers table also uses the SendGrid emailer now.

How will this affect users?
Users will be able to leverage the SendGrid emailer for the full range of Solicitation Email options.


ENHANCEMENT:  Extend Pricing Sub-Table for E-Sourcing
Reference #: 250624.1250.2389

The Pricing Line Items Table has been modified so when users create a new Contract from an E-Sourcing record with pricing line items, the pricing line items will carry over into the Contract if they are assigned to the Awarded Vendor.

How will this affect users?

Users will have an easier workflow when creating Contracts from E-Sourcing records.


ENHANCEMENT:  Remove ID fields from Bid Rating Weight table on Solicitation
Reference #: 250624.1250.2273

We have removed Solicitation ID, Solicitation Rating Weight ID, and Solicitation Rating Weight GUID from the grid when viewing the Bid Rating Weight table. If you click View on a Record you will be able to see the ID fields that were removed.

How will this affect users?

Users will have a cleaner view and easier time seeing important information on the Bid Rating Weight table
